19. Oscillator
a. Performance Check
(1) Adjust TI DET GAIN control cw from PWR OFF position and GEN DET
switch AC DET INT 1 KHz.
(2) Connect frequency counter to TI R-L1 (high) terminal and EXT BIAS 1 (low)
terminal. Frequency counter will indicate between 990 and 1010 Hz.
b. Adjustments. No adjustments can be made.
20. Capacitance
a. Performance Check
(1) Position TI controls as listed in (a) through (c) below:
(a) FUNCTION switch to CDx0.01 SERIES.
(b) D-Q SERIES dial to 0.
(c) RANGE switch to Cx0.01 F.
(2) Insert capacitance standard into 2C and 3C terminals.
(3) Adjust TI LRC dial, D-Q SERIES dial, and DET GAIN control to obtain best
null indication on TI meter.
(4) If LRC dials do not indicate within 0.2 percent plus (+) one dial division of
certified value of standard capacitor, perform b below.
b. Adjustments
(1) Remove TI from case.
(2) Set RANGE switch to 0.1 F.
(3) Set TI LRC dials to 1.000.
(4) Adjust D-Q dials and trim capacitor C1 (attached to capacitance standard
located above the transformer) alternately until null is obtained on meter (R).
(5) Install TI in its case.
